4. Then, the leading edge of the document advances to the Drive Roller 1 position, and then passes through the Slip Detect Sensor.
At this time, if the document does not advance within a defined period, the pressure applied to the Separation Roller from the
Double-feed Prevention Roller is strengthened to prevent the document from slipping.
(For the pressure mechanism, see Fig. 6.1.2.)
When the leading edge of the document reaches the Slip Detect Sensor, the Paper Feed Motor will stop.
(Fig. 6.1.2) Pressure Mechanism
5. When the leading edge of the document passes through the Starting Sensor, image scanning starts after a defined period.
(i.e., the time required for the document to advance from the Starting Sensor to the scanning start point)
6. The document passes through the Exit Sensor and exits from the scanner.
7. When the trailing edge of the document passes through the Waiting Sensor, the Paper Feed Motor is driven again to feed
the 2nd document.
8. 2 to 7 above are repeated.
Note:
When the scanners buffer becomes full, the scanner stops to prevent buffer overflow, while continuing
to allow data to be transferred to the PC.
